The fourth industrial revolution has resulted in technologies that can improve processes ranging from design to operational decisions. The AEC industry has, however, been plagued with challenges such as slow adoption and integration of these technologies. This paper introduces the industry 4.0 tools and elucidates the challenges to adoption, especially at the O&M stage of existing buildings. It explores BIM as a driver for creating digital twins focusing on sustainability assessment. This study presents a brief background of the concepts and a concise review of extant literature. It subsequently uses VOSviewer and scientometric analysis to map out in a visual manner the most influential papers on the subject. Searches on the primary database Scopus identified for the study resulted in 449 documents, which were narrowed down to 412 to range from 2017 to 2022. A network visualisation of keywords, countries with the most citations and co-authorship is presented along with the implications and opportunities for future research, especially in Malaysia.
